Abstract
In this correspondence, we propose a vector-radix algorithm for fast computation of 3-D discrete Hartley transform(DHT). For data sequences whose length is a power of three, a radix-3×3×3 decimation in frequency algorithm is developed. It decomposes a length-N×N×N DHT into twenty-seven length-(N/3)×(N/3)×(N/3) DHTs. Comparison of computational complexity with known algorithms shows that the proposed algorithm, in some cases, reduces significantly the number of arithmetic operation.
